Center Township is a township in Hodgeman County, Kansas, United States. [1] As of the 2000 census, its population was 1,121.
Center Township covers an area of 144.34 square miles (373.8 km2) and contains one incorporated settlement, Jetmore (the county seat). According to the USGS, it contains two cemeteries: Fairmount and Saint Lawrence.
The stream of Spring Creek runs through this township.
